vine-users ML アーカイブ



[vine-users:050952] Re: ThinkPad A21P Video ports.

  • From: Mitsuhiro ABE <abem@xxxxxxxxxxx>
  • Subject: [vine-users:050952] Re: ThinkPad A21P Video ports.
  • Date: Thu, 30 May 2002 17:48:32 +0900
安部と申します。

ThinkPad A21P のビデオ入力に関する Vine2.5の動作について、
もう少し詳しい情報を報告致します。

ビデオ信号を取り込むツール xawtv は、エラーを出力しております。
(ここから)------------------------------------------
This is xawtv-3.50, running on Linux/i686 (2.4.18-0vl3)
Xv: ATI Rage128 Video Overlay: input image, ports 55-55
  image format list for port 55
    0x32595559 (YUY2) packed
    0x59565955 (UYVY) packed
    0x32315659 (YV12) planar
    0x30323449 (I420) planar
Xv: using port 55 for hw scaling
x11: 1600x1200, 16 bit/pixel, 3200 byte/scanline, DGA
can't open /dev/video: No such device
v4l-conf had some trouble, trying to continue anyway
open /dev/video: そのようなデバイスはありません
v4l: open /dev/video: そのようなデバイスはありません
no video grabber device available
(ここまで)-----------------------------
のエラーを返してきております。

/dev/video ができておりませんでしたので、
/etc/module.conf に、
alias char-major-81 bttv
を追加して立ち上げなおしますと、
$ ls -al /dev/video*
lrwxrwxrwx    1 root     root            6 Apr  3 04:48 /dev/video ->
video0
crw-------    1 myuname  root      81,   0 Jan 29  2000 /dev/video0
crw-------    1 myuname  root      81,   1 Jan 29  2000 /dev/video1
のようなものができておりました。
#grep video /var/log/message の結果は、
 kernel: Linux video capture interface: v1.00
 kernel: i2c-core.o: i2c core module
 kernel: i2c-algo-bit.o: i2c bit algorithm module
 kernel: bttv: driver version 0.7.83 loaded
 kernel: bttv: using 2 buffers with 2080k (4160k total) for  capture
 kernel: bttv: Host bridge is Intel Corp. 440BX/ZX - 82443B X/ZX Host bridge
 kernel: bttv: Host bridge needs ETBF enabled.
 insmod: /lib/modules/2.4.18-0vl3/kernel/drivers/media/video/bttv.o: 
 init_module: No such device
 insmod: Hint: insmod errors can be caused by incorrect module parameters, including invalid IO or IRQ parameters
 insmod:/lib/modules/2.4.18-0vl3/kernel/drivers/media/video/bttv.o: insmod char-major-81 failed
と返しています。

最初に、/usr/doc/kernel-doc-2.4.18/video4linux/bttv/README を見ますと、
/etc/module.confオプションに options i2c-algo-bit bit_test=1 の方法があり、
つぎに、/usr/doc/kernel-doc-2.4.18/video4linux/bttv/CARDLIST を見ますと、
  card=63 - ATI TV-Wonder
  card=64 - ATI TV-Wonder VE
などなどとありますので
/etc/module.confオプションの options bttv card=63
とか、64のケースを設定して動いて欲しいのです。
残念ながら、/sbin/depmod -av も行ったのですが、動かないようです。

/etc/module.conf の設定のみで動けば、大変、嬉しいのですが、
識者の方、いらっしゃいましたら、よろしくお願い致します。

安部光洋